The Mechanics of Paw-Some Travel Plans
Planning a Paw-Some Travel Plan requires careful consideration of several factors, including accommodation, transportation, and pet care. Pet owners must research and book pet-friendly accommodations, such as hotels, vacation rentals, and camping sites. They must also consider the cost of transportation, including airfare, car rentals, and train tickets.
Pet Travel Documents
Pet owners must also obtain the necessary travel documents for their pets, including health certificates, vaccination records, and import permits. The type and cost of these documents vary depending on the destination and the type of pet.
Traveling by Air
For international travel, pet owners must also consider the costs associated with traveling by air. This includes the cost of a pet carrier, airline fees, and customs clearance.
